Opfyx Ltd in London is seeking a Software Engineer to join a small, high-impact team building a modern AI-enabled aviation platform. You will design, build, and operate distributed systems using Rust and Flutter, collaborating with stakeholders to ship live, mission-critical software for airports and airlines, with focus on reliability, performance, and a scalable architectural approach.
The role offers close collaboration with a CTO who is an Apache Arrow and DataFusion contributor.
